Kentucky catcher Coltyn Kessler signs with Miami Marlins

Kentucky catcher Coltyn Kessler recently signed a free agent contract with the Miami Marlins.

Here are details from UK:

LEXINGTON, Ky. – Kentucky catcher Coltyn Kessler has signed a free agent contract with the Miami Marlins, joining an organization that also selected pitcher Holt Jones in this month’s Major League Baseball Draft.

The Marlins’ signing of Kessler represents the sixth UK player they have drafted or signed since 2015, including OF Tristan Pompey and LHP Andrew Miller in 2018, IF Riley Mahan (2017), RHP Dustin Beggs (2016) and OF Kyle Barrett (2015). Zach Pop, an important piece of the bullpen during UK’s 2017 Super Regional run, was acquired by the Marlins last offseason and made his major league debut in 2021.
